  <Header type="string" UID="faf9fd2842b549d09e761cd943c2be20" label="Header" readonly="false" hidden="false" required="false" indexable="false" CIID="">Guideline Statement 37</Header>
  <BodyCopy type="xhtml" UID="41a2d8598c364193bbfe9ad86d7bcd3c" label="Body Copy" readonly="false" hidden="false" required="false" indexable="false" Height="" CIID="">&lt;p&gt;&lt;strong&gt; &lt;/strong&gt;&lt;strong&gt;In patients with a history of low-grade Ta disease who experience a small papillary recurrence, clinicians may offer surveillance and/or in-office fulguration or chemoablation as an alternative&lt;/strong&gt; &lt;strong&gt;to TUR under anesthesia. (&lt;em&gt;Expert Opinion&lt;/em&gt;) &lt;/strong&gt;&lt;/p&gt;</BodyCopy>

  <DiscussionBody type="xhtml" UID="9bbbac02721d4eefba59c63ee7ff9007" label="Discussion Body" readonly="false" hidden="false" required="false" indexable="false" Height="" CIID="">&lt;p&gt;Patients with low-grade Ta bladder cancer represent a challenge since they often have recurrences but have little overall risk to their health from these tumors. A recent retrospective review demonstrated a very low-risk of progression from low-grade to high-grade disease (8%).&lt;sup&gt;324&lt;/sup&gt; However, patients are often subjected to repeat TURBT&amp;rsquo;s resulting in increased health care costs, risks associated with repeat anesthetics, and the burden of scheduling and time commitment. There have been several reviews which have examined deintensification strategies. A few recent reviews examining strategies like in-office fulguration, active surveillance, and chemoablation found improved quality of life for patients as well as lower costs and less morbidity without compromising oncologic efficacy.&lt;sup&gt;325, 326&lt;/sup&gt; Prospective, randomized trials comparing surveillance office-based fulguration to operating room-based resection for small, papillary bladder tumors in low-risk NMIBC patients have not been completed. Several centers have reported on retrospective cohort series of office-based endoscopic fulguration of small bladder masses with acceptable oncologic outcomes.&lt;sup&gt;71, 327-329&lt;/sup&gt; While these cohort series varied in their inclusion criteria, in general, office-based fulguration was restricted to patients with known low-grade Ta disease in which the size of the tumor was small (typically defined as less than 0.5 to 1.0 cm). This suggests that selected patients with low-risk NMIBC and isolated, small, papillary recurrences may be effectively managed with office-based, endoscopic fulguration with local anesthesia and sedation. This has the potential to spare a patient the risks associated with anesthesia required for a more invasive resection in an operating room setting. In a recent retrospective study of 270 patients with recurrent Ta, low-grade NMIBC treated with office fulguration, the 10-year incidence of cancer-specific mortality and disease progression were 0% and 3.1% (95% CI: 0.8% to 5.4%), respectively.&lt;sup&gt;330&amp;nbsp;&lt;/sup&gt;For highly selected patients, clinicians may opt for watchful waiting or conservative management in those patients for whom the risks of fulguration may outweigh the risks of disease progression. This might include those cases where in-office fulguration is not readily available or patients who require ongoing anti-coagulation. It should be noted that it does appear that patients with multiple TURs and/or multiple lesions may be at higher risk for disease progression and failing surveillance.&lt;sup&gt;331, 332&lt;/sup&gt; Several retrospective studies and meta-analyses suggest that risk stratification of low-grade tumors may help guide therapy.&lt;sup&gt;333&lt;/sup&gt; Patients with larger tumors (&amp;gt;3 cm), multiple tumors, and shorter times to recurrence (&amp;lt;1 year) have higher recurrence rates, and although still low, higher rates of progression. Therefore, when deciding on more conservative management, clinical features should be included in shared decision-making with the patient.&lt;/p&gt;
&lt;p&gt;A more recently approved option is the administration of UGN-102 for low-grade intermediate-risk bladder cancer. In the ENVISION trial, 240 patients received UGN-102 for recurrent low-grade NMIBC (intermediate-risk). The primary endpoint was a complete response rate at 3 months of 79.6% and a durable response rate of 82% at 12 months in those achieving a complete response rate.&lt;sup&gt;154&lt;/sup&gt; As a result of the trial, the FDA approved the use of UGN-102 for recurrent low-grade intermediate-risk NMIBC.&lt;/p&gt;
&lt;p&gt;However, the Panel felt several important caveats should be kept in mind. A fulguration or chemoablative approach that does not obtain tissue for pathologic evaluation should not be utilized unless a diagnosis of low-grade Ta disease or papillary urothelial neoplasm of low malignant potential (PUNLMP) has been previously established. A fulguration approach should be restricted to those patients in whom the lesion is papillary in appearance, rather than sessile or flat, and is no more than 1 cm in size. Furthermore, patients in whom a urinary cytology is suspicious for urothelial carcinoma are at higher risk for harboring occult high-grade disease and warrant pathologic evaluation of any visible lesion. Upper tract imaging to assess occult disease also may be considered in patients who develop repeated recurrences of small papillary lesions in the bladder.&lt;/p&gt;</DiscussionBody>
